First Express Company.

The first express company In America was launched 79 years ago, when an advertisement appeared in the Boston and New York papers announcing that “William F. Harnden has made arrangements with the Providence railroad and the New York Boat company to run a car through from Boston to New York and vice versa four times weekly. He will accompany the ear himself, take care of all small packages that may be Intrusted to his care and -*see them safely delivered.” Today Harnden might be prosecuted for publishing a misleading advertisement, for his “express car” was entirely Imaginary, and he carried parcels In a valise. Harnden had long l>een a conductor on the railway, and Ws former associates permitted him to travel without charge, The railroad got nothing in the way of express charges. Harnden’s first competitor ■was Alvin Adams, who became the founder of the Adams Express company.
